Keeping hospital rooms clean is a top priority at Tomah Health.

So hospital officials have started a national certification program to ensure that staff who clean the facility… Environmental Services Technicians … are among the best in the industry.

According to Tomah Health Facility Services Director Steve Loging, the American Hospital Association’s Certified Health Care Environmental Services Technician …or CHEST program, helps validate the cleanliness of the hospital and the skill of staff.

Loging said only a few area rural health care facilities have embarked on the certification program.

He said the hospital kicked off the initiative by securing a grant, which enabled him to obtain a “train the trainer” certification, which allows him to run the classes for the nearly 20 hospital staff.

He hopes to complete the staff training in the next 18 months.
